carolorbill pollak

Quite a nice surprise, we stopped in for dinner and most everything surpassed our expectations. It's not the most impressive dining room, but that's the only negative I can give. First the drinks came and they were enormous from the mixed drinks to the wine pours, delicious as well! Next we ordered a variety from seafood, pork chops, and Chicken Parm... each one was enough for four meals and they were as good or better than any Italian restaurants I've been to in the area. Seafood was extremely fresh and after eating to capacity, it still went home in a FULL half sheet pan!! Pork chop was equally gigantic and both tender and juicy with great flavor. the chicken parm was two large (as big as the plate) cutlets that were perfectly cooked and served with just the right amount of sauce and cheese. We were never rushed and enjoyed everything. This will definitely be a favorite for when we have a big appetite and the urge for some NJ/NY style Italian feast. The price was more than reasonable, considering the number of meals we will eventually get from the dinner! Give it a try...
